Bisquertt La Joya Gran Reserva Syrah 2012, Colchagua Valley, Chile: Black fruit and lots of charred oak. Full-bodied. Pair with a pepper steak. Drink: 2013-2016. 325407 14.50% D 750 mL  $14.95 Score: 87/100. March 21, 2015 Blissful Blue Cheese Wine Full Review
Zenato Valpolicella Superiore 2012, Veneto D.O.C., Italy: Full-bodied, juicy and tasty with attractive dark red berries and cedar smoke. Perfect for so many dishes with robust flavours. Great value in this robust Italian red wine from the Valpolicella region. Lots of mouth-watering acidity. Pair with pastas in meat sauce or sausages. Drink: 2014-2018. 995704 13.50% D 750 mL  $18.95 Score: 89/100. April 4, 2015 Best Value Red Wine. Perfect Pasta and Tomato Sauce Wine Full Review
